What is Microsoft Azure?

Launched almost a decade ago, in 2010, Azure is a private and public cloud platform by Microsoft that allows developers and IT professionals to build, test, deploy, and manage applications & services through a network of data centers created by Microsoft globally.

It offers an assortment of services that include software as a service (SaaS), platform as a service (PaaS), and infrastructure as a service (IaaS). Whether it is Microsoft-specific or third-party software & systems, the programming languages, frameworks, or tools that Microsoft Azure supports range widely. As of now, it offers over 600 services.

Why Microsoft Azure is considered the best?

1. The Availability of SaaS, PaaS, and IaaS

All three services SaaS, PaaS, and IaaS by one provider make it easy for businesses to install simple virtual machines or deploy stacks of full applications across a cloud environment.

2. Cost-Effective

The pay-as-you-go model offered by Microsoft Azure allows businesses to save a lot by only paying for the services they would be using.

3. Flexibility & Scalability

Businesses can easily integrate data with processes that too at a cloud scale through the flexibility offered by its structure as well as its efficient storage capabilities.

4. Widespread Availability

Through its gigantic global footprint and the global network of data centers, Microsoft Azure migration services allow businesses to easily migrate their data and applications wherever they want.

5. Tough Security

The first CSP that embraced ISO 27018 i.e. cloud privacy’s new international standard, Microsoft Azure also meets ISO 27001 and HIPAA compliance.

How does Microsoft Azure work?

Like any other cloud service, Azure is based on a technology called virtualization. You already know that almost all computer hardware can be matched with software. Now with the use of an emulation layer software instructions are mapped with hardware instructions, and virtualized hardware is executed in software by physical servers placed in data centers in such a way that it’s hard to make out whether the hardware is virtual or actual.
